Potentially One of the more distressing activities an individual can go through is aquiring a health and fitness insurance plan declare denied. In any case the effort of securing protection, keeping up with quality payments, and navigating the network requirements, a denial looks like a betrayal. Denied wellness insurance coverage promises come about for a number of explanations: missing information and facts, coding problems, pre-present problems, or just a willpower by the insurance company which the process is “not medically vital.” Regardless of the motive, the influence is often devastating, especially when the treatment method is important for a person’s recovery or maybe survival.
Studying the way to struggle well being insurance policies conclusions becomes crucial in these situations. Whilst it might sound frustrating, there are actually steps customers might take to charm denied statements. First of all, being familiar with your plan is important. Recognizing what is roofed, exactly what is excluded, and the way to navigate the appeals approach may make a major variation. Most insurers give a detailed explanation of Gains (EOB) in addition to a denial letter, which outlines The rationale for the decision. Cautiously examining this data is step one in difficult the result.
The appeals course of action normally starts having an inner evaluation. This suggests distributing a proper request with the insurance company to rethink their determination. This request really should be accompanied by documentation—including doctor’s notes, clinical records, and letters of professional medical necessity—that guidance the case to the treatment. In many conditions, insurers reverse their decisions at this time, particularly when the original denial was as a consequence of incomplete or unclear details.
However, not all appeals are productive at The interior amount. In this kind of scenarios, individuals have the correct to pursue an external critique. This will involve a third-celebration Firm, generally appointed by the state or perhaps a federal agency, reviewing the claim as well as the insurance company’s denial. The result of this assessment is binding, that means the insurance company have to comply with the decision. Whilst this process may take time and demands persistence, it really is An important recourse for individuals who truly feel they happen to be unfairly denied coverage.
